Babe Ruth autographs show up with regularity on cuts, photos, single-signed balls, team-signed balls, and just about any flat surface that a wild-eyed fanatic could grab when catching a glimpse of "The Bambino" approaching. But one such item that you rarely see adorning a Babe Ruth signature is the one that makes the most sense; a baseball card. It's not all that surprising considering that Ruth entered the league years after the T206 series and just about every issue Ruth appeared in was regional and limited in production. It wasn't until the 1933 Goudey series that baseball cards were again distributed nationwide, allowing collectors the opportunity to get a Babe Ruth autograph on not just one but four different card issues. Maybe it was because Ruth was in the twilight of his career at the time, or maybe it was just that people though having Ruth sign a card just wasn't as appealing as something larger and more personal like a photo, but the result is that there are very few Babe Ruth autographed cards out there. Just recently, a few have sold publicly (and privately) for well into six-figure territory, sporting Ruth autographs that rate in the PSA/DNA 6 to 8 range. But the hobby has never seen anything like the item offered here; a PSA/DNA 9 MINT autograph of Babe Ruth on a 1933 Sport Kings card. While Sport Kings was also produced in 1933 and a Goudey Gum product, it was primarily a collection of subjects from lesser celebrated sports and activities, along with Babe Ruth and Ty Cobb, and didn't enjoy the same popularity as the Goudey baseball series, so it was even less likely to be the canvas for a Babe Ruth signature. This example is not just the only one ever evaluated by PSA/DNA; it's the only one known to exist! For that reason alone, the value of this specimen is clearly in excess of the recently sold Goudey signed cards, but the fact that the signature is superior to all other known specimens, evaluated to be MINT by PSA/DNA with additional LOA from JSA, adds another dimension to this one of a kind masterpiece that makes it worthy of an honored place in the Baseball Hall of Fame. Ruth has signed the card in bold black ink over several creases that run horizontally but does not detract from the vivacity of the autograph. The first letter in Babe is perhaps a half-shade lighter than the rest of the letters in his full name, likely the only reason the signature wasn't deemed GEM MINT though is probably still deserving of the honor.
